Is it possible for a single NMEA 2000 device to function as both a talker and a listener?

Explanation:
In NMEA 2000, a device on the network can both transmit data (be a talker) and receive data (be a listener) at the same time. The bus is designed for devices to publish PGNs and also subscribe to PGNs from others, so a single unit can generate its own data streams while listening to data from sensors or other devices. This dual role is common in practice—for example, a multifunction display might broadcast its own position or status while simultaneously listening to depth, speed, or wind information from other devices. The idea that a device must be either a talker or a listener isn’t correct, since many devices implement both capabilities.
